These tools are grounded in the Corentus Team Wheel framework, which outlines four key dimensions of team effectiveness:
Collaboration & Cohesion, Mutual Accountability, Common Purpose & Shared Goals, and Roles & Competencies.
Within the four dimensions, 22 elements can be found, and for each of these, we’ve developed both Main Tools and MicroTools to support targeted team development.
We define a Main Tool as: A robust collection of contextual insights, MicroTools, client cases, and more that help teams develop new skills and competencies.
We define a MicroTool as: A short, focused practice that can be taught and used in less than 10 minutes, ideal for busy teams that want to see immediate results.
